You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end Iowa State University. It ranked #1 on our 2023 Most Veteran Friendly in the Plains States Region for Construction Engineering for a Bachelor’s list. Located in Ames, Iowa, this large public school awarded 59 degrees to qualified bachelors’s construction engineering students in 2020-2021.

In addition to being on our plains states region bachelor’s degree vets studying construction engineering list, Iowa State has also earned the #1 rank in our “Best Construction Engineering Bachelor’s Degree Schools in the Plains States Region” ranking.According to our most recent data, Iowa State University supports 31,822 students, and 814 of those are GI Bill® students, of which 388 are Post-9/11 GI Bill® recipients. The average Post-9/11 GI Bill® award for tuition and fees at the school was $7,933. In addition to receiving other benefits, 9 students qualified for the Yellow Ribbon Program. Students may be able to receive credit for their military training, depending on their background.
